Strong's Dictionary Number: [1768]
1768
1 Original Word: דִּי
2 Word Origin: apparently from (01668)
3 Transliterated Word: diy
4 TDNT/TWOT Entry: TWOT - 2673
5 Phonetic Spelling: dee
6 Part of Speech:
7 Strong's Definition: (Aramaic) apparently for [01668;]01668; that, used as relative conjunction, and especially (with a preposition) in adverbial phrases; also as preposition of:--X as, but, for(-asmuch +), + now, of, seeing, than, that, therefore, until, + what (-soever), when, which, whom, whose.
8 Definition: part of relation - who, which, that mark of genitive
- that of, which belongs to, that conj
- that, because
9 English:
0 Usage: × as, but, for(-asmuch +), + now, of, seeing, than, that, therefore, until, + what(-soever), when, which, whom, whose
